Optony Partners with Colorado Energy Group (CEG) on Solar Strategy for City of Boulder
Optony and Boulder-based partner CEG began work on a citywide local energy masterplan that includes a focus on solar and storage for the City’s own facilities. Within a few weeks, the Optony and Colorado Energy Group strategy grabbed media attention in a front-page article in Boulder’s principal daily news service.
